The journey from Chail to Guwahati takes you from the mountains to the gateway of Northeast India. You will need to reach Delhi to catch a train to Guwahati. Guwahati is a vibrant city on the banks of the Brahmaputra River, known for its temples and natural beauty.

Total Distance: 2000 km by road, 1700 km air distance.
Fastest Way
Flight from Chandigarh to Guwahati.
Cheapest Way
Train from Delhi to Guwahati.

Things to Do in Guwahati
1
Kamakhya Temple
A famous temple dedicated to Goddess Kamakhya, located on Nilachal Hill.
2
Umananda Island
A small island in the Brahmaputra River with a temple dedicated to Lord Shiva.
3
Assam State Museum
A museum with a vast collection of artifacts from the Northeast.
4
Deepor Beel
A large wetland and bird sanctuary, perfect for nature lovers.
